Pours a rusty opaque brown, some reddish tinge, but very hazy and brown. Fairly large tannish head that laces well, dies to a small layer and clings to the sides. Aromas throw a solid Flanders feel, with some darker malts lingering with a nice tartness, sour, touch of funk and oak, dryness, with a nice cherry fruit feel. Light tannins, very nice. Initial is medium in body, throwing a light mellow maltiness, followed up by light tartness, sour, and oaky on the front. Moves to a bit of a full body, sour cherries are light but discernible, wet oak, and a touch of lactic on the backend. Tart sour finish is decent in strength, really makes this beer sessionable, but underflavored. Decent for the style, a little under what I was expecting. illidurit (889), Santa Cruz, California, USA
